AT&T Specialist App/Prod Support in Chennai, India

Job Description:

Responsibilities and Day-to-Day View

5+ Years of technical hands-on, problem-solving experience in Engineering Operations / production support responsibilities with a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) focus in a J2EE environment, ensuring the stability, performance, and continuous improvement of web applications and services.

• Incident Management: Lead the response to production issues, ranging from identifying and troubleshooting problems to implementing immediate fixes. Ensure minimal downtime and adherence to service level agreements (SLAs).

• Observability: Build alerting, monitoring and dashboards that identify problems proactively;

• Problem Solving: Utilize strong analytical, technical and functional skills to diagnose and resolve complex issues within production environments with a focus on immediate impact mitigation; work with dev teams to implement long-term solutions to prevent recurrence of incidents.

• Run Books and Documentation: Create and maintain comprehensive documentation for system architecture, configuration, deployment procedures, and troubleshooting guides

• Automation: Develop and maintain scripts and automation tools to streamline operations, deployment processes, and repetitive tasks. Focus on automating recovery processes and routine maintenance tasks to improve system reliability and efficiency

• Non Functional Requirements : Working with development teams, identify and provide the non-functional requirements and acceptance criteria during design and development, and ensure that these are met prior to moving the features to production

• Performance Optimization: Monitor application performance using APM (Application Performance Management) tools such as Dynatrace, App Dynamics and ELK. Identify bottlenecks and work with dev teams to optimize the performance of applications through code improvements, configuration tuning, and resource optimization.

• Adopt SRE best practices: Work with dev teams to define Non-Functional Requirements such as reliability, performance, scalability, application logging for observability, etc. Define SLI/SLOs, Error Budgets, Automation focus

• Conduct Blameless Postmortems / After Action Reviews: Work with dev/architect/quality engineering teams to identify and document patterns of failures as lessons learnt from incidents and follow up to implement the remediations to make the application resilient

• Capacity Planning: Monitor system usage patterns and perform capacity planning to ensure scalability and reliability of applications and services.

• Security: Participate in security assessments and implement security best practices to safeguard applications and data. Respond promptly to security incidents and vulnerabilities

• Release Management: Work with Release Management related to upcoming changes to production to identify risks and mitigate them. Collaborate with development teams to manage and support application releases and deployments. Ensure changes are rolled out in a controlled manner with minimal impact on production services.

• Problem Management Engineering Expertise: Proactive problem detection, trend and pattern analysis, assessment of impact of problems, functional analysis of problems. Management of Escalated issues, tracking and driving prompt resolution.

• Communication: Provide metrics and status reports and review with leadership and stakeholder communities; establish processes surrounding metrics gathering, reporting and communication; Provide prompt visibility and status of escalated issues, incidents and outages to leadership, business partners and other key stakeholders; Strong verbal and written communication skills

• Knowledge Transfer: Work closely with Product Development teams to ensure Knowledge Transfer related to changes to the system well in advance of change getting operationalized

• On-call 24x7 support for agent facing applications – Home Grown J2EE apps as well as SaaS Platform apps - Salesforce, Salesforce Marketing Cloud and Mulesoft
